Ferrocalc is the rules engine that computes shipping fees for all Dunmark storefronts. Rules are YAML, evaluated top-down, first match wins. Never edit rules in place; submit a change set and let the Ferrocalc validator run the regression suite against last quarter's order sample. Fee discrepancies almost always trace back to overlapping zone predicates, so check rule ordering before anything else. Deploys go out twice weekly. The rule syntax reference and the validator workflow are documented on the page below.

runbook for tafof-yawif: https://confluence.tolvaqsys.internal/display/display/browse/pages/7be3

## Build Provenance: Fernwhistle Markdown Renderer

This page explains how support can confirm which renderer build produced a customer's page. Each rendered document embeds a provenance footer tied to a signed build record. If a customer reports garbled tables or stripped links, collect that footer value before escalating — it tells engineering exactly which sanitizer and parser versions ran. Builds are reproducible, so engineering can replay the exact render locally. The current production build token appears below.

build token for fahap-yagag: htk3_d09

Before resuming the leaked-file-descriptor hunt on the Fennick plugin host, restore the audit account carefully: verify the descriptor tracker logs are intact, confirm no plugin holds stale handles, and re-enable tracing only after restoration completes. To unlock the recovery console, enter the passphrase shown on the next line exactly as written.

vault phrase of bagaf-kajeg = jorath-feniel-briir-siliel-ralix

Handover — Pinefold Clinic reminders

Cron job moved to the Dovetail scheduler; retries now capped at three. Failed SMS batches land in the dead-letter queue; drain weekly. Release manager must unlock the notifier vault before redeploy. Unlocking needs the recovery passphrase, which is written directly below this note.

recovery phrase for fawif-tajeg: norael-aldmir-casir-brivan-ulaion